Eating Shrimp During Pregnancy
Eating Shrimp During Pregnancy - The simple answer is yes, you can eat shrimp while pregnant. They also are low in fat content and high in protein, making them a healthy choice for pregnant mothers. Cook shrimp and lobster until the flesh is pearly and milky white. “shrimp are typically safe to eat during pregnancy with some caveats,” says alyssa dweck, md, ms, facog, a.
